"מים בלבד שהופכים לטיח, ידיים ריקות שיוצרות קריירה חדשה הן באמת מרשימות." לימוד כתיבת תוכנה הוא דומה, בהתחלה זה יכול להיות קשה, אבל אם מתמידים, אפשר בהחלט "ליצור קריירה חדשה" בתחום זה. האם אתם מחפשים דרכים לכתוב תוכנה? אל דאגה, מאמר זה ידריך אתכם מא' עד ת'. גם אם אתם לא יודעים כלום, אל תהססו. אף פעם לא מאוחר ללמוד, כמו איך לקחת את אשתך וילדיך ללימודים בחו"ל, תמיד יש דרך אם אתם באמת רוצים.

תכנות 101: תחילת המסע

כתיבת תוכנה היא לא רק הקלדת קוד, אלא גם תהליך יצירתי. ראשית, עליכם לקבוע את מטרת התוכנה: איזה בעיה היא פותרת? מי קהל היעד? לאחר מכן, בחרו שפת תכנות מתאימה. ישנן שפות תכנות רבות, לכל אחת יתרונות וחסרונות משלה. לדוגמה, Python קלה ללמידה, Java חזקה, C++ בעלת ביצועים גבוהים. בהתאם למטרה וליכולת שלכם, בחרו את השפה המתאימה. זה כמו לבחור שיטה כיצד ללמד ילדים סימני גדול וקטן, צריך להתאים לכל ילד.

![בחור יושב ליד שולחן עם מחשב נייד, מהרהר איזו שפת תכנות לבחור עבור פרויקט התוכנה שלו. הוא מוקף ספרים ורשימות על שפות שונות כמו Python, Java, C++ ו-JavaScript. התמונה מתארת את השלב הראשוני של פיתוח תוכנה שבו בחירת הכלי הנכון היא קריטית.](image-1|hoc-viet-phan-mem-tin-hoc-lua-chon-ngon-ngu|Lựa chọn ngôn ngữ lập trình|A person is sitting at a desk with a laptop, contemplating which programming language to choose for their software project. They are surrounded by books and notes about different languages like Python, Java, C++, and JavaScript. The image depicts the initial stage of software development where choosing the right tool is crucial.)

עיצוב תוכנה: תוכנית לעתיד

לאחר בחירת השפה, עליכם לעצב את התוכנה. זהו שלב חשוב, כמו שבניית בית זקוקה לתוכנית. עיצוב תוכנה כולל עיצוב ממשק משתמש (UI) ועיצוב חוויית משתמש (UX). UI הוא המראה החיצוני של התוכנה, בעוד UX הוא האופן שבו משתמשים מקיימים אינטראקציה עם התוכנה. תוכנה טובה צריכה להיות בעלת UI ו-UX יפים וקלים לשימוש. יש פתגם "התחלה טובה היא חצי הדרך", אם העיצוב טוב, כתיבת הקוד תהיה הרבה יותר קלה. מר נגויין ואן א', מומחה תכנות באוניברסיטת טכנולוגיית המידע בהאנוי, הדגיש בספרו "סודות התכנות היעיל" את חשיבות עיצוב התוכנה.

כתיבת קוד: מימוש רעיונות

זה השלב שבו אתם מתחילים לכתוב קוד, להפוך רעיונות למציאות. זכרו לכתוב קוד נקי, קריא, מובן וקל לתחזוקה. זה עוזר לכם ולעמיתים לעבוד עם הקוד בהמשך. אל תשכחו לבדוק את התוכנה באופן קבוע כדי לזהות ולתקן באגים. בדיקה היא כמו "מבחן אש", עוזרת לכם להבטיח את איכות התוכנה. אתם יכולים גם לעיין בללמוד איך לכתוב מכתב B2 כדי לשפר את כישורי הכתיבה שלכם בצורה ברורה ועקבית, ליישם אותם בכתיבת קוד.

![מפתח תוכנה בודק בקפידה את הקוד שלו במספר מכשירים, כולל מחשב נייד, טאבלט וסמארטפון. הוא בודק באגים, מוודא היענות ומאמת שהתוכנה פועלת כמצופה בפלטפורמות שונות.](image-2|viet-phan-mem-tin-hoc-kiem-thu-phan-mem|Kiểm thử phần mềm|A software developer is meticulously testing their code on multiple devices, including a laptop, tablet, and smartphone. They are checking for bugs, ensuring responsiveness, and verifying that the software functions as expected across different platforms.)

פריסה ותחזוקה: מסע שטרם הסתיים

לאחר סיום, עליכם לפרוס את התוכנה כדי שמשתמשים יוכלו להשתמש בה. עם זאת, העבודה לא נגמרת שם. עליכם לתחזק את התוכנה, לתקן באגים, לעדכן תכונות חדשות. כמו לשתול עץ, לאחר השתילה, אתם עדיין צריכים להשקות ולטפל כדי שהעץ יגדל היטב. אנשים רבים מתעניינים באיך לחשב תשלום לפי נקודות אקדמיות כמו גם בלימוד תכנות, שניהם זקוקים לחישוב קפדני וזהירות.

רוחניות בתכנות

אנשים וייטנאמים נוהגים לערוך טקסי "סבים וסבתות קדומים" לפני תחילת עבודה חשובה. בתכנות זה דומה, למתכנתים רבים יש הרגל "לבקש עזרה משמיים" לפני איתור באגים בקוד קשה. זהו מאפיין תרבותי רוחני מעניין, המשקף כבוד ותפילה למזל טוב.

![צוות של מפתחי תוכנה עובד יחד במשרד מודרני, עוקב אחר שרתים ומנתח משוב משתמשים. הם עוסקים באופן פעיל בתחזוקה ושיפור מתמשכים של מוצר התוכנה שלהם.](image-3|trien-khai-phan-mem-bao-tri-phan-mem|Triển khai và bảo trì phần mềm|A team of software developers is working together in a modern office, monitoring servers and analyzing user feedback. They are actively engaged in the ongoing maintenance and improvement of their software product.)

סיכום

כתיבת תוכנה היא מסע ארוך, הדורש התמדה ומאמץ. אני מקווה שמאמר זה סיפק לכם ידע בסיסי על איך לכתוב תוכנה. התחילו את המסע שלכם היום! אל תשכחו להשאיר תגובה, לשתף את המאמר ולגלות תכנים נוספים באתר "ללמוד לעשות". צרו קשר בטלפון: 0372888889, או בכתובת: 335 Nguyen Trai, Thanh Xuan, Hanoi. צוות שירות הלקוחות שלנו זמין 24/7.

You may also like...